Key takeaway: NNAT3 asks students to reason with shapes and patterns rather than reading passages. That nonverbal design can reduce vocabulary barriers, but it is not culture-free, and schools still decide how any NAI or percentile fits a broader identification process.

NNAT3, the Naglieri Nonverbal Ability Test, Third Edition, is a Pearson nonverbal ability assessment for kindergarten through grade 12. It uses geometric designs in yellow and blue in official materials, along with pattern and relationship tasks that do not require reading, writing, or speaking to complete. What NNAT3 measures

NNAT3 is designed as a nonverbal measure of general ability. Its visual format can reduce the influence of English vocabulary on some tasks, but it is not culture-free and should not be interpreted as a complete picture of a child’s intelligence, creativity, or classroom achievement.

Schools may use NNAT3 for screening, program evaluation, placement conversations, or gifted identification alongside other evidence. Pearson describes it as group-administered, available online or on paper, with 48 multiple-choice items in about a 30-minute administration. The school determines the exact format, eligibility rules, and how results are used.

NNAT3-style reasoning can include pattern completion, analogy, serial reasoning, spatial visualization, rotation, reflection, matrices, counting, and shading changes. The useful habit is to name the rule briefly, then test that rule against every part of the image before choosing an answer.

NNAT3 levels and grade mapping

NNAT3 level Typical school grade
A Kindergarten (K)
B Grade 1
C Grade 2
D Grades 3-4
E Grades 5-6
F Grades 7-9
G Grades 10-12

Pearson lists two forms for Levels A-D and one form for Levels E-G. Third-party providers may emphasize early-level practice packs, but Pearson remains the source for higher-level official administration details.

NAI, percentiles, stanines, and local gifted policy

Reports can include the Naglieri Ability Index (NAI), percentile ranks, stanines, scaled scores, and NCEs by age. Families should confirm the reporting convention and norm group with the school. There is no universal gifted cutoff that applies in every district; local criteria may combine multiple measures, grade rules, and review procedures.

Naglieri Ability Index

School materials often describe the NAI with a mean near 100 and a standard deviation of 16. It is a norm-referenced ability index for this assessment family, not a percentage correct and not a complete intelligence profile.

Percentile ranks and stanines

A percentile compares a result with the relevant norm group. It is not the same as the number of questions answered correctly. Stanines place results into nine broad bands that are easier to scan but less detailed than a percentile.

NNAT, NNAT2, and NNAT3

Pearson has published more than one edition of this assessment family. NNAT3 is the current third edition with updated content, norms, and administration options. Earlier editions such as NNAT and NNAT2 used different norms and materials. A result from an older edition should not be mechanically converted to NNAT3. Ask the school which edition and norm year apply before comparing scores across years or siblings.

NNAT3 compared with CogAT and OLSAT

NNAT3 is often grouped with other school ability assessments, but the formats differ in ways that matter for preparation.

  • CogAT includes verbal, quantitative, and nonverbal batteries. See our CogAT test guide.
  • OLSAT 8 also spans verbal, nonverbal, and quantitative areas across Levels A-G. See our OLSAT test guide.

A student who does well on one publisher’s nonverbal tasks is not guaranteed the same outcome on another publisher’s full battery. Practice the visual reasoning habits NNAT3 emphasizes, but do not treat one sample set as a stand-in for a different test.

FAQ

Is NNAT3 an IQ test?

It is a nonverbal ability assessment, not a complete measure of a child’s intelligence, creativity, attainment or potential. The school should explain how it fits its wider process.

Does a high percentile guarantee gifted placement?

No. Criteria are local and may include multiple measures, grade-specific rules and review procedures.
